Chinese Arrested for Drug Trafficking in Phnom Penh House
Cambodia News (Phnom Penh): Chbar Ampov police collaborated with the Anti-drug department in a raid on a house where drugs were being packed in Sangkat Niroth, Khan Chabar Ampov, Phnom Penh.
The police arrested two Chinese men found at the scene: LIU JIE, 40 years old, and CHAN HUNG FAI, 58 years old.
The drug evidence, such as 40 packets of blue pills, 26 packs of powder, and 4 packs of colored pills, was confiscated and returned to the Anti-drug Department of the Ministry of the Interior.

Re: Chinese Arrested for Drug Trafficking in Phnom Penh House
UPDATE: Another arrest has been made and nearly 7kgs of drugs seized.
Cambodia News, (Phnom Penh): Experts from the Anti-Drug Department cracked down on cross-border drug trafficking hidden in land (via Cambodia to Vietnam), arrested a Chinese drug criminal and confiscated nearly 7 kg of drugs in Phnom Penh that were destined to be trafficked into Vietnam by a gang of Chinese nationals.
On May 12, 2021, at 11:35am, the specialized force of the Department of Anti-Drug Crimes launched an operation to crack down on cross-border drug trafficking at Orussey Bus Station, Street 105, Sangkat Boeung Prolit, Khan 7 Makara and searched the house No. 482BIS, Mekong River Road, Sangkat Khan Chroy Changva, Phnom Penh.
Police arrested a major drug criminal: Chinese national, FAN YI, male, born on 01/07/1972, living at the above address. The authorities searched the premises and discovered almost a kilogram of MDMA hidden in a floor fan.
Altogether, police seized 1. Ecstasy (MDMA) weighing 971.77g (hidden in vertical fan stand). 2. Ketamine (Ketamine) weighs 5 kg 578.95g. 3. Methamphetamine (ICE) 93.19 g. They captured a total of 6 kg 643.91 g of drug exhibits.
This case is believed to be related to a previous drug crackdown on 12 May, 2021, which resulted in the arrest of two Chinese men.

Re: Chinese Arrested for Drug Trafficking in Phnom Penh House
UPDATE
Cambodia News, (Phnom Penh): On the afternoon of May 18, 2021, three Chinese men who were involved in drug trafficking nearly 80 kilograms of various illegal drugs across the border from Cambodia to Vietnam have been remanded in custody by the Phnom Penh Court.
The three suspects are identified as LIU JIE, CHAN HUNG FAI, and FAN YI, all Chinese nationals.
